Reserve: Joan Buckley Betty Barnes Paul Winter Steve McHale Alex McNellan Brian Hatter Graham Parker Steve Wilson Paul Rafferty Mick Eunson Lionel Sams Jimmy Griffiths Robbie Smith Stuart Stubbs Nicky Turner Peter Connolly Mens Team Manager: Neil Wells Terry Allen Frank Smith Graham Wilson Dave Whitcombe Ronnie Bretherton Ladies Team Manager: Reserve: Eva Holden Team Manager's: Fran Lynch Allen Fuller & Lew Shannon MENS B' MATCH Rules apply as the British Darts Organisation Rules apply as the British Darts Organisation Singles 501 up, straight starts, double finish, best of 5, legs to each game. Ladies Singles 501 up, straight starts, double finish, best of 5 legs to each game. Ladies only 501 up, best of 3 legs. ORDER OF THROW. Visitors to throw first on first only 501 up, best of 3 legs. ORDER OF THROW. Visitors to throw first on first and third legs of games 1, 3, 5, 7, 9, 11. Lanes throw first on games, 2, 4, 6, and third legs of games 1, 3, 5, 7, 9, 11. Lanes throw first on games, 2, 4, 6, 8, 10, 12. Where marked * Player throws first. One point for each game is awarded 8, 10, 12. Where marked * Player throws first. One point for each game is awarded to the winner, two points are awarded for a win, one point to each team for a draw. to the winner, two points are awarded for a win, one point to each team for a draw.
